    Re: Home Made Wall Tents?

    Quote Originally Posted by BiG Boar View Post
    I was wondering just yesterday if one of those car port style tarp doohickies with a propane heater inside would work. Cheap at costco, big and weather resistant.
    The trouble with propane heat especially in a plastic tarp is the moisture collects and it "rains" inside the enclosure. Wood heat works but you have to have a wall made of something other than plastic behind the stove.

    Re: Home Made Wall Tents?

    Quote Originally Posted by stitch View Post
    the car port works great. Use plywood on each end with a wood stove up at the ranch...you can't beat the price and comfort.
    This set up definately works great. The Costco units are around $200 bucks and come with windows now and the corners seal up much better. I have the older version which I cut down the uprights down about 16"; but there is still tons of head room. Use plywood or OSB for the wood stove end and a sheet metal sleeve for the pipe. Fashion a door in the other end out of the same material and you have a cozy structure with tons of room. I agree you get some condensation, but I think that could be easily over come by installing a vent in the peak (on the to do list).

    A wall tent is the real deal, but this is pretty liveable at a fraction of the cost. The other nice touch is that you do not have to worry about mildew or rot.
